html - App Discovery 小部件强制隐藏

标签 html css iframe widget

我刚刚在 Apple 的网站上发现了 Widget Builder [ https://widgets.itunes.apple.com/builder/]我正在尝试在我雇主的网站上实现它。它基本上是您在网站上托管的 iframe,充当小部件,它应该是最容易实现的代码:

<iframe src="https://widgets.itunes.apple.com/widget.html?c=us&brc=FFFFFF&blc=FFFFFF&trc=FFFFFF&tlc=FFFFFF&d=&t=&m=software&e=software,iPadSoftware&w=250&h=300&ids=585027354&wt=discovery&partnerId=&affiliate_id=&at=&ct=" frameborder=0 style="overflow-x:hidden;overflow-y:hidden;width:250px;height: 300px;border:0px"></iframe>

但是,当将代码放在我的 html 中时,iframe 变得隐藏,这是由于以下样式属性已强制进入 iframe:

display: none !important; visibility: hidden !important; opacity: 0 !important;

请注意,这些样式元素并未出现在原始 iframe 中,而是以某种方式强加到其中的。我在我的私有(private)网站上设置了一个没有任何标记的空白 HTML 文档 [ http://www.vanjaarsvelt.com/app.php]并得到完全相同的结果。当然,我用谷歌搜索了这个问题,但不幸的是无济于事。

我完全不知道这背后是什么以及如何解决它。甚至 Apple 的文档 [ https://www.apple.com/itunes/affiliates/resources/documentation/widgets.html]没有提到任何与我的问题有远程联系的事情。如果有人可以阐明我遇到的这个问题,我将不胜感激,在此先感谢!

最佳答案

我很惭愧,我没有想到在 Safari 中禁用我的广告拦截器扩展程序。至少它证实了我对我的编码的信任。

关于html - App Discovery 小部件强制隐藏,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24590618/

相关文章:

7 秒幻灯片图像后的 Javascript

javascript - 如果屏幕缩小,则更改 <h1> 的文本

css - 创建 CSS/DIV 布局的最佳指南或资源是什么?

c# - 将生成的 PDF 数据加载到 ASP.NET MVC 上的 IFRAME 中

html - iframe 中的 WCAG 2.0 问题

javascript - 当我在 html 和 css 中向下滚动时,如何使图像位于菜单栏后面?

javascript - 根据其他输入字段有条件地显示/隐藏未嵌套的标签/输入表单字段

jquery - 砌体应用后 Div 的高度设置为 0

jquery - 当 iframe 的父窗口滚动时,帮助我在 iframe 中重新居中 ModalPopup

css - 默认居中对齐 DIV 并左对齐